Job Description

  • Teaching Assistant for Conservation Biology class (ESS 5630) in the fall. Attend class sessions (fully in person) and help answer questions and provide support to small groups of students during in-class labs (3.5 hours/week).
  • Arrange time outside of class to be available to students for working on class assignments and the final project, and to provide tutoring in content and skills to students who need additional support (3 hours/week).
  • Assistant may also help with grading assignments (1.5 hour/week), finding Conservation Biology topics in the current news (1 hour/week), and preparing for class (1 hour/week).
  • Work will occur during class time as well as outside of class as arranged with individuals or groups of students.

Qualifications

  • Applicants should have:

    • A strong background in Conservation Biology, and have already taken the class at AUNE in a past year.
    • Strong communication skills and attention to detail
    • Ability and interest in working with other graduate students to build knowledge and skills
    • Ability to attend class on Fridays
